He made money, but could have made more.

After the “young seat three" donks off a big stack to the “clueless seat one" on the final table, we are 4 handed.  With about 600,000 chips in play, approx stack sizes are;

Peter Kwan                  110,000
Me                     40,000
“Clueless seat one”                             280,000
Trevor Payne                170,000

Peter asks quietly if we’d be interested in a four way split of £800 each. Trevor hears this and is a bit surprised. I hear it and say it’d be OK with me. At this stage “Clueless seat one” with nearly half the chips doesn’t hear it. The next hand is dealt, Peter folds and I have A 10 s and am contemplating either a raise or an all in with my 10bb’s (blinds are 2,000/4,000). I pause and wonder about mentioning the deal again. I tell Peter again that I’d be happy to split, but none of us can quite bring ourselves to raise such a ridiculous proposal with the chip leader. Eventually Peter suggests it out loud and “Clueless seat one” considers it, consults his mate who’s watching, looks at the stacks and considers it some more. I suggest that it’d be a good result & a good nights work for us all. Just as I think he’s about to propose an alternative deal (and Trevor is telling him the win is £1,250), he says, “I tell you what, if I lose this hand, we’ll split it.” I fold my A 10 quickly, he looks at his cards and folds his small blind, giving Trevor a walk. The clincher is when I say its “a risk free £800.” He agrees to the deal and we play one final hand for official places.

I get K7 and proceed to miss the board entirely, but so does everyone else. “Clueless seat one” wins with ace high and my king takes 2nd.   Nina and Niall are watching and can’t believe how lucky Peter and I have been to get such a good deal.  Credit is due to Peter for suggesting it and following through. Thanks also to Trevor for not objecting to a deal that wasn’t great for him. He wanted “Clueless seat one” to object, but he didn’t get the message!
